On my first trip to Goa, we stayed at Colva Beach in South Goa. Colva is one of the most popular beaches in the south. The south is much quieter and less developed than the north. If youre looking for action, this is not the place to go, but if you want peace and relaxtion, this is the place.
Colva Beach has managed to keep all the hotels off the beach. Youll find a clean beach with( most of the time) blue water and palms trees almost to the shore. The water can be rough so be careful when swimming. The beach has some nice shacks for lunch and a cold beer or two. Water sports/parasailing are available from the beach.
There are beach sellers here( as on almost all the beaches - best to ignore them) . Watch the stray dogs as well.
